top of page

Contact

We are located in the Christopher Ingold building.

​

Derek Macmillan
Department of Chemistry
University College London
20 Gordon Street
London, WC1H 0AJ

 

Tel: 020 7679 4684


E-mail: d.macmillan@ucl.ac.uk


Tel: +44 (0) 131 650 4712

​

​

bottom of page